What Were the Signature Moves of These Wrestlers?

Signature moves played a significant role in defining a wrestler's character and in-ring persona. Here are some iconic moves from the wrestlers from the '80s and '90s list:

  • Hulk Hogan: The Leg Drop
  • Stone Cold Steve Austin: The Stone Cold Stunner
  • The Rock: The Rock Bottom
  • Shawn Michaels: The Sweet Chin Music

What Were the Most Memorable Matches from This Era?

Wrestling fans can easily recall some of the most thrilling matches that defined the careers of these wrestlers. Here are a few unforgettable bouts:

  • Hogan vs. Andre the Giant at WrestleMania III
  • Bret Hart vs. Shawn Michaels at WrestleMania XII
  • Stone Cold vs. The Rock at WrestleMania X-Seven

What Are the Personal Details and Biographical Highlights of Key Wrestlers?

NameDate of BirthBirthplaceNotable Achievements
Hulk HoganAugust 11, 1953Augusta, Georgia, USA6-time WWE Champion
Stone Cold Steve AustinDecember 18, 1964Austin, Texas, USA3-time WWE Champion
The RockMay 2, 1972Hayward, California, USA8-time WWE Champion
Ric FlairFebruary 25, 1949Memphis, Tennessee, USA16-time World Champion
